WebA small amount of ethylene is oxidized to carbon oxides and some chlorinated hydrocarbon by-products are formed. About l-2< 7o of the ethylene feed to the reactor leaves unreacted in the vent gas from the system. A simplified process flow diagram depicting an air-based fluidized bed oxychlorination system is shown in Figure 14 [22]. WebThere is provided an improvement in the process for the catalytic gas phase oxychlorination of ethylene. The process comprises reacting ethylene, hydrogen chloride and a member of the group of air and oxygen in an iron-type reactor to produce, 1,2-dichloroethane. WebNov 1, 2024 · The oxychlorination of ethylene is an industrially relevant process within the manufacture of polyvinyl chloride (PVC). Although RuO 2 is the best performing catalyst for the Deacon process (4HCl + O 2 → 2H 2 O + 2Cl 2 ), experiments demonstrate a modest activity in the selective oxychlorination to vinyl chloride, favouring oxidation and ... WebA review. Ethylene oxychlorination is the key technol. in vinyl chloride (VCM, the monomer of PVC, polyvinyl chloride) prodn. to close the chlorine loop by consuming the HCl released from the former cracking step. Due to the high demand for PVC, leading ethylene oxychlorination being one of the most important processes in the industry.
